linux
记录日常linux
lizhibin007
南昌大学程序猿一枚
展开
-
Linux shell脚本批量解压文件
如下,在test目录下有两个.tar.gz及一个tgz文件。现在编写一个tar_for.sh脚本。vim tar_for.sh然后赋予脚本755权限,chmod 755 tar_for.sh。再执行就OK了原创 2020-11-18 10:25:56 · 2089 阅读 · 0 评论 -
linux中$* 与$@的区别
一下是shell 位置参数变量的含义:举个例子:原创 2020-11-07 10:28:32 · 794 阅读 · 0 评论 -
Linux命令之PS详解
首先运行 ps aux,结果如下图:接着运行 :pstree,结果如下(以树形式返回):原创 2020-11-02 16:46:48 · 85 阅读 · 0 评论 -
Crontab 清理多个日志
1.创建一个日志清理shell脚本(log_clean.sh)[root@localhost log]# vim /root/log_clean.sh注:上面图中的 /dev/null(也叫黑洞,表示 的是一个黑洞,通常用于丢弃不需要的数据输出),就是黑洞将/var/log/messages及/var/log/secure文件清空.2.查看定时任务列表[root@localhost log]# crontab -e代表每分钟执行一次log_clean.sh脚本,每个*的意义如下:3.重原创 2020-10-29 20:06:09 · 511 阅读 · 0 评论 -
Linux权限对目录与文件的作用与区别
原创 2020-10-19 22:50:12 · 125 阅读 · 0 评论 -
httpd(apache)源码包安装
首先说明一般开发用源码包,适合多人访问,效率高。安装准备我这选择 httpd-2.2.9.tar.gz(2.4后有麻烦) 作演示:解压 httpd-2.2.9.tar.gztar -zxvf httpd-2.2.9.tar.gzcd httpd-2.2.9vim INSTALL 查看安装提示教程如上图,分四步:首先指定安装目录,一般安装在/usr/local/下,我选择如下:./configure --prefix=/usr/local/apache2编译(讲机器语原创 2020-10-18 21:00:59 · 669 阅读 · 0 评论 -
Centos6,7搭建本地yum源三步骤
原创 2020-10-17 08:23:07 · 176 阅读 · 0 评论 -
常见Linux目录名称功能
原创 2020-10-14 07:53:31 · 105 阅读 · 0 评论 -
Linux达人计划1 解压缩命令汇总(zip,gz,bz2,tar.gz,tar,bz)笔记
原创 2020-10-10 19:16:24 · 72 阅读 · 0 评论 -
vim 简单命令使用
vim aaa输入:vim + aaa,跳到最后vim +(数字) aaa ,跳到指定行,大于最大行,则跳到最后例如,vim +5 aaavim aaa,在1,3行输入hellovim +/hello aaa ,找到hello出现的第一次行数按n可以在多个hello间切换vim aa bb cc,创建多个文件,按Esc,输入:n,可以向下一个文件间切换,输入:N或:prev,返回上一个文件...原创 2020-10-08 19:56:49 · 129 阅读 · 0 评论 -
Linux Shell 更改别名 永久生效方法
首先输入如下命令 vi /root/.bashrc例如加入 alias vi='vim'重启Linux生效或输入如下命令:原创 2020-10-04 21:51:26 · 555 阅读 · 0 评论 -
Linux第一个有颜色的”HelloWorld“ shell 脚本
[root@localhost ~]# vim hello.sh输入如下命令:#!/bin/bash#The first programecho -e "\e[1;36m HELLO WORLD \e[0m"输入如下两个命令都可以:[root@localhost ~]# ./hello.sh[root@localhost ~]# bash hello.sh同时附上字体颜色表:...原创 2020-10-04 21:15:44 · 152 阅读 · 0 评论 -
systemctl status|start |start|restart nginx.service Unit nginx.service could not found问题
这是配置完nginx后,没有配置环境变量的问题:跟windows的cmd命令窗口运行 mysql一样(mysql 不是内部命令)的问题首先[root@local ~]# vim /etc/init.d/nginx打开文件编辑加入PATH=$PATH:/usr/local/nginx/sbin (以你安装的nginx目录为准)在执行如下图命令:最后执行 exec bash --login 使文件生效...原创 2020-09-26 21:43:18 · 11539 阅读 · 0 评论 -
Centos 7下安装nginx,使用yum install nginx,提示没有可用的软件包,最可靠解决方案--压缩包安装。
相信很多小伙伴 使用yum安装ngnix出现如下问题:yum -y install nginx已加载插件:fastestmirror, langpacksLoading mirror speeds from cached hostfilebase: mirrors.aliyun.comextras: mirrors.aliyun.comupdates: mirrors.aliyun.com没有可用软件包 nginx。错误:无须任何处理网上有很多方案,但我现在示范的是最可靠的方案–压缩原创 2020-09-26 19:11:05 · 1893 阅读 · 3 评论 -
linux上下传文件
linux Xshell中用:rz 打开窗口 ,从Windows中选择文件下载到linux(一般在/tmp中)同理在linux Xshell中:sz + 文件名 ,打开窗口上传文件到 windows中原创 2020-09-24 16:37:16 · 113 阅读 · 0 评论 -
linux scp命令移动文件
下载上传原创 2020-09-24 16:21:07 · 819 阅读 · 0 评论